## Ownership

This module implements retry semantics for webhook delivery in Saltmere Relay: exponential backoff with jitter, a five-attempt cap, and dead-letter routing after final failure. Changes to backoff constants or dead-letter behavior require a design note, since downstream consumers depend on current timing guarantees. Future maintainers should read the delivery-state diagram before editing. Questions about this component go to the owner named below.

approver of yajef-fajef = Oliwyn Silion Kasok Kasox

## Authentication

Migratron performs zero-downtime schema migrations for the Corvella platform. Before running any migration plan, the CLI must authenticate against the internal SchemaPort service; support staff should use the shared operations credential rather than personal tokens. Set it via the MIGRATRON_TOKEN environment variable. The current key is below.

app token of yajop-tawif = kto3_vib

Subject: Cut-over complete — bulk edits in the admin table

Hi Marit,

The cut-over for bulk editing in the Tallowgrove admin table finished last night. Row selection, batch status changes, and the undo window all behave as they did in staging. We removed the legacy per-row PATCH path and routed everything through the new batch endpoint. One straggler: the audit log shows batch IDs instead of row IDs, which Deva is tracking separately. For your review, the production configuration the service picked up at cut-over is listed below.

settings of fadup-kajog:
[casox]
port = 3000
team = jorix
host = casox.paliqio.example
region = lower-4
access_code = ac_dd069a
timeout_ms = 750